An indictment was unsealed right this moment charging seven nationals of the Folks’s Republic of China (PRC) with conspiracy to commit pc intrusions and conspiracy to commit wire fraud for his or her involvement in a PRC-based hacking group that spent roughly 14 years concentrating on U.S. and international critics, companies, and political officers in furtherance of the PRC’s financial espionage and international intelligence aims.

The defendants are Ni Gaobin (倪高彬), 38; Weng Ming (翁明), 37; Cheng Feng (程锋), 34; Peng Yaowen (彭耀文), 38; Solar Xiaohui (孙小辉), 38; Xiong Wang (熊旺), 35; and Zhao Guangzong (赵光宗), 38. All are believed to reside within the PRC.
